Best Value Histologic Technician Schools
For return on investment in histologic technician, no school beat Lanier Technical College this year. Set in the city of Gainesville, Lanier Technical College is a moderately-sized public institution. Students from in state pay about $3,980 in tuition and fees, while out-of-state students pay about $7,190. Students borrow a median of $12,278 to complete the histologic technician program here. Early-career histologic technician graduates make about $37,118. That is a strong return on a $12,278 median debt.
Albany State University came in at #2 on our 2026 list of the best value histologic technician schools. Located in the city of Albany, Albany State University is a moderately-sized public university. Expect in-state tuition and fees of around $5,656, with out-of-state students paying around $17,008. Typical student debt for histologic technician graduates is $15,179. Histologic Technician graduates of Albany State University earn a median of $50,815 early in their careers. That is a strong return on a $15,179 median debt.
